You need 2 references for your travel document application. Your references must 1. be 18 years of age or older 2. have known you for at least 2.1. 2 years for passport applications 2.2. 6 months for certificate of identity and refugee travel document applications 3. agree to you using their name and contact … See more You need a guarantor for your travel document application. As long as they meet these requirements, your guarantor can be anyone, including a family member or member of your household. 1. Requirements for a … See more

WebOne referee should be a person of any nationality who has professional standing (see list below). The other referee must normally be the holder of a British citizen passport and either a professional person or over the age of 25. In both cases, they must have known the person applying for citizenship for 3 years or more.
